Web04. apr 2016. · OpenMP:在while循环中并行化循环 c for-loop parallel-processing openmp hpc 2016-04-04 121 views 1 likes 1 我正在实现一种使用强制执行的计算图形布局的算法。 我想添加OpenMP指令来加速一些循环。 在阅读了一些课程之后,根据我的理解,我添加了一些OpenMP指令。 该代码已编译,但不会返回与顺序版本相同的结果。 OpenMP: … Web01. feb 2024. · Hi! On 2024-01-13T14:53:16+0000, Hafiz Abid Qadeer wrote: > Currently we only make use of this directive when it is associated > with an ...
OpenMP設定 · parallel_processing
Web02. avg 2024. · omp_get_dynamic Returns a value that indicates if the number of threads available in upcoming parallel regions can be adjusted by the run time. C++ int omp_get_dynamic(); Return value A nonzero value means threads will be dynamically adjusted. Remarks Dynamic adjustment of threads is specified with omp_set_dynamic … Web29. nov 2024. · omp atomic may seem like a duplication of omp critical but it is different in that omp critical is a generalized mutual exclusion mechanism and can wrap any kind of code, while omp atomic limits the kinds of operations that it supports. Based on these restrictions, the compiler can, in principle, generate more optimized code. dinner on the queen mary long beach
[Solved] How to parallelize do while and while loop in openmp?
Webmatout(numGenes,8); 计划的pragma omp并行(静态) for(int gene2=0;gene2 然而,我发现在变量out中写入的输出是随机顺序的。 我的意思是out(1,)没有对应于“gene2=1”的输出。 Web22. okt 2014. · 在C/C++中使用OpenMP优化代码方便又简单,代码中需要并行处理的往往是一些比较耗时的for循环,所以重点介绍一下OpenMP中for循环的应用。个人感觉只要掌握了文中讲的这些就足够了,如果想要学习OpenMP可以到网上查查资料。 工欲善其事,必先利其器。如果还没有搭建好omp开发环境的可以看一下OpenMP ... Web22. nov 2011. · OpenMP并行构造的schedule子句详解. schedule子句是专门为循环并行构造的时候使用的子句,只能用于循环并行构造(parallel for)中。. • static: Iterations are divided into chunks of size chunk_size. Chunks are assigned to threads in the team in round-robin fashion in order of thread number. dinner on the river seine